.InterviewerTab_container__Md_QH{padding:2rem;max-width:1400px;margin:0 auto}.InterviewerTab_header__TmTWS{margin-bottom:3rem;text-align:center}.InterviewerTab_header__TmTWS p{color:#b0b0b0;font-size:1.1rem;margin:0}.InterviewerTab_loading__69Isn{text-align:center;color:#b0b0b0;font-size:1.2rem;padding:2rem}.InterviewerTab_createSection__rT7Uu{margin-bottom:3rem;display:flex;justify-content:center}.InterviewerTab_createButton__OEYZy{background-color:#007acc;color:white;border:none;padding:12px 24px;border-radius:8px;font-size:1rem;font-weight:500;cursor:pointer;transition:background-color .2s ease}.InterviewerTab_createButton__OEYZy:hover:not(:disabled){background-color:#005fa3}.InterviewerTab_createButton__OEYZy:disabled{background-color:#666;cursor:not-allowed}.InterviewerTab_projectSection__J4r1X{margin-bottom:2rem}.InterviewerTab_projectSectionHeader__aI3d3{display:flex;justify-content:space-between;align-items:center;margin-bottom:1.5rem}.InterviewerTab_projectSectionHeader__aI3d3 h2{color:#f5f5f5;font-size:1.5rem;margin:0;font-weight:500}.InterviewerTab_filterContainer__3SNiM{display:flex;align-items:center;gap:.5rem}.InterviewerTab_filterLabel__Rv8yS{color:#b0b0b0;font-size:.9rem;font-weight:500;white-space:nowrap}.InterviewerTab_filterDropdown__xSxKa{padding:8px 12px;border:1px solid #555;border-radius:6px;background-color:#333;color:#f5f5f5;font-size:.9rem;outline:none;cursor:pointer;transition:border-color .2s ease,background-color .2s ease;min-width:140px}.InterviewerTab_filterDropdown__xSxKa:focus{border-color:#007acc;background-color:#2a2a2a}.InterviewerTab_filterDropdown__xSxKa:hover:not(:disabled){background-color:#2a2a2a}.InterviewerTab_filterDropdown__xSxKa:disabled{background-color:#444;color:#888;cursor:not-allowed;opacity:.6}.InterviewerTab_filterDropdown__xSxKa option{background-color:#333;color:#f5f5f5;padding:8px}.InterviewerTab_emptyState__J85eF{text-align:center;padding:3rem;color:#888;background-color:#2a2a2a;border-radius:8px;border:1px solid #444}.InterviewerTab_emptyState__J85eF p{margin:0;font-size:1.1rem}.InterviewerTab_projectTable___lxpR{background-color:#2a2a2a;border-radius:8px;border:1px solid #444;overflow:hidden}.InterviewerTab_tableHeader__1p29n{display:grid;grid-template-columns:2fr 1fr 1fr 1fr 2fr;grid-gap:1rem;gap:1rem;padding:1rem 1.5rem;background-color:#333;border-bottom:1px solid #444;font-weight:600;color:#f5f5f5;font-size:.9rem;text-transform:uppercase;letter-spacing:.5px}.InterviewerTab_tableBody__CYowT{display:flex;flex-direction:column}.InterviewerTab_tableRow__czemA{display:grid;grid-template-columns:2fr 1fr 1fr 1fr 2fr;grid-gap:1rem;gap:1rem;padding:1rem 1.5rem;border-bottom:1px solid #444;transition:background-color .2s ease;align-items:center}.InterviewerTab_tableRow__czemA:hover{background-color:#333}.InterviewerTab_tableRow__czemA:last-child{border-bottom:none}.InterviewerTab_columnName__mWzyh{display:flex;align-items:center;min-width:0}.InterviewerTab_projectName__X9MOd{color:#f5f5f5;font-weight:500;font-size:1rem;text-overflow:ellipsis;white-space:nowrap;overflow:hidden}.InterviewerTab_columnCreated__BpKEA,.InterviewerTab_columnStarted__l5xKz{color:#b0b0b0;font-size:.9rem}.InterviewerTab_columnStatus__CQ8lK{display:flex;align-items:center}.InterviewerTab_statusBadge__5_Pnl{padding:.25rem .5rem;border-radius:12px;font-size:.75rem;font-weight:500;text-transform:uppercase;letter-spacing:.5px}.InterviewerTab_statusBadge__5_Pnl.InterviewerTab_created__DkwPt{background-color:#17a2b8;color:white}.InterviewerTab_statusBadge__5_Pnl.InterviewerTab_started__Jd5H1{background-color:#ffc107;color:#333}.InterviewerTab_statusBadge__5_Pnl.InterviewerTab_finished__6zl5_{background-color:#28a745;color:white}.InterviewerTab_statusBadge__5_Pnl.InterviewerTab_reviewed__Uzc7s{background-color:#6f42c1;color:white}.InterviewerTab_columnActions__BCyoe{display:flex;gap:.5rem;align-items:center;justify-content:flex-end}.InterviewerTab_reviewButton__V1fN_{background-color:#6c757d;color:white;border:none;padding:6px 12px;border-radius:4px;font-size:.8rem;cursor:pointer;transition:background-color .2s ease}.InterviewerTab_reviewButton__V1fN_:hover:not(:disabled){background-color:#5a6268}.InterviewerTab_reviewButton__V1fN_:disabled{background-color:#495057;cursor:not-allowed;opacity:.6}.InterviewerTab_copyButton__hktT9{background-color:#17a2b8;color:white;border:none;padding:6px 12px;border-radius:4px;font-size:.8rem;cursor:pointer;transition:background-color .2s ease}.InterviewerTab_copyButton__hktT9:hover:not(:disabled){background-color:#138496}.InterviewerTab_copyButton__hktT9:disabled{background-color:#6c757d;cursor:not-allowed;opacity:.6}.InterviewerTab_deleteButton__cMivG{background-color:#dc3545;color:white;border:none;padding:6px 12px;border-radius:4px;font-size:.8rem;cursor:pointer;transition:background-color .2s ease}.InterviewerTab_deleteButton__cMivG:hover:not(:disabled){background-color:#c82333}.InterviewerTab_deleteButton__cMivG:disabled{background-color:#6c757d;cursor:not-allowed;opacity:.6}.InterviewerTab_pagination__XT6pN{display:flex;justify-content:center;align-items:center;gap:1rem;margin-top:2rem;padding:1rem}.InterviewerTab_paginationButton__R5Zpv{background-color:#007acc;color:white;border:none;padding:8px 16px;border-radius:6px;font-size:.9rem;cursor:pointer;transition:background-color .2s ease}.InterviewerTab_paginationButton__R5Zpv:hover:not(:disabled){background-color:#005fa3}.InterviewerTab_paginationButton__R5Zpv:disabled{background-color:#666;cursor:not-allowed}.InterviewerTab_paginationInfo__eRhYk{color:#b0b0b0;font-size:.9rem;margin:0 1rem}.InterviewerTab_modalOverlay__N_3O0{position:fixed;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,.7);display:flex;align-items:center;justify-content:center;z-index:1000}.InterviewerTab_modal__GhuHC{background-color:#2a2a2a;border:1px solid #444;border-radius:8px;padding:2rem;max-width:500px;width:90%;max-height:90vh;overflow-y:auto}.InterviewerTab_modal__GhuHC h3{color:#f5f5f5;margin:0 0 1.5rem;font-size:1.2rem;font-weight:600}.InterviewerTab_formGroup__rXokb{margin-bottom:1.5rem}.InterviewerTab_label__d0JqL{display:block;color:#f5f5f5;font-size:.9rem;font-weight:500;margin-bottom:.5rem}.InterviewerTab_input__5Sb_j{width:100%;box-sizing:border-box;padding:12px 16px;border:1px solid #555;border-radius:6px;background-color:#333;color:#f5f5f5;font-size:1rem;outline:none;transition:border-color .2s ease}.InterviewerTab_input__5Sb_j:focus{border-color:#007acc}.InterviewerTab_input__5Sb_j::placeholder{color:#888}.InterviewerTab_input__5Sb_j:disabled{background-color:#444;color:#888;cursor:not-allowed}.InterviewerTab_modalButtons__gPpwO{display:flex;gap:.75rem;justify-content:flex-end}.InterviewerTab_confirmButton__BDYwT{background-color:#007acc;color:white;border:none;padding:10px 20px;border-radius:6px;font-size:.9rem;cursor:pointer;transition:background-color .2s ease}.InterviewerTab_confirmButton__BDYwT:hover:not(:disabled){background-color:#005fa3}.InterviewerTab_confirmButton__BDYwT:disabled{background-color:#666;cursor:not-allowed}.InterviewerTab_cancelButton__apvzW{background-color:transparent;color:#b0b0b0;border:1px solid #555;padding:10px 20px;border-radius:6px;font-size:.9rem;cursor:pointer;transition:all .2s ease}.InterviewerTab_cancelButton__apvzW:hover:not(:disabled){background-color:#444;color:#f5f5f5}.InterviewerTab_cancelButton__apvzW:disabled{opacity:.5;cursor:not-allowed}@media (max-width:1024px){.InterviewerTab_tableHeader__1p29n,.InterviewerTab_tableRow__czemA{grid-template-columns:2fr 1fr 1fr 1.5fr;gap:.5rem}.InterviewerTab_columnStarted__l5xKz{display:none}}@media (max-width:768px){.InterviewerTab_container__Md_QH{padding:1rem}.InterviewerTab_projectSectionHeader__aI3d3{flex-direction:column;align-items:flex-start;gap:1rem}.InterviewerTab_filterContainer__3SNiM{align-self:stretch;justify-content:space-between}.InterviewerTab_filterDropdown__xSxKa{min-width:120px}.InterviewerTab_tableHeader__1p29n,.InterviewerTab_tableRow__czemA{grid-template-columns:2fr 1fr 1fr;gap:.5rem}.InterviewerTab_columnCreated__BpKEA,.InterviewerTab_columnStarted__l5xKz{display:none}.InterviewerTab_columnActions__BCyoe{flex-direction:column;gap:.25rem;align-items:stretch}.InterviewerTab_copyButton__hktT9,.InterviewerTab_deleteButton__cMivG,.InterviewerTab_reviewButton__V1fN_{font-size:.7rem;padding:4px 8px}.InterviewerTab_modal__GhuHC{padding:1.5rem;margin:1rem}.InterviewerTab_pagination__XT6pN{gap:.5rem}.InterviewerTab_paginationInfo__eRhYk{margin:0 .5rem;font-size:.8rem}}@media (max-width:480px){.InterviewerTab_tableHeader__1p29n,.InterviewerTab_tableRow__czemA{grid-template-columns:1fr 1fr;gap:.5rem}.InterviewerTab_columnStatus__CQ8lK{display:none}.InterviewerTab_columnActions__BCyoe{justify-content:flex-start}}.LoadingModal_backdrop__3assD{position:fixed;top:0;left:0;right:0;bottom:0;background-color:rgba(0,0,0,.8);display:flex;align-items:center;justify-content:center;z-index:10000}.LoadingModal_spinner__cihyb{width:48px;height:48px;border:4px solid rgba(255,255,255,.3);border-left-color:#00a67e;border-radius:50%;animation:LoadingModal_spin__qBLhn 1s linear infinite}@keyframes LoadingModal_spin__qBLhn{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@media (max-width:768px){.LoadingModal_spinner__cihyb{width:40px;height:40px;border-width:3px}}@media (max-width:480px){.LoadingModal_spinner__cihyb{width:36px;height:36px}}.Start_container__fvhKK{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:70vh;padding:2rem;max-width:600px;margin:0 auto}.Start_titleSection__Q9PNk{text-align:center;margin-bottom:2rem}.Start_title__ld2KS{font-size:2.5rem;font-weight:600;color:#f5f5f5;margin:0 0 1rem;letter-spacing:-.025em}.Start_subtitle__fT07k{font-size:1.1rem;color:#00a67e;font-weight:500;margin:0}.Start_instructionsCard__YOuE1{background-color:#2a2a2a;border:1px solid #444;border-radius:12px;padding:1.5rem;margin-bottom:1.5rem;box-shadow:0 4px 6px rgba(0,0,0,.1);box-sizing:border-box;max-width:600px;width:100%}.Start_instructionsHeader__PgGct{font-size:1.2rem;font-weight:600;color:#f5f5f5;margin:0 0 1rem;display:flex;align-items:center;gap:.5rem}.Start_instructionsIcon__5fMHQ{font-size:1.5rem}.Start_instructionsText__ACgUg{font-size:1rem;line-height:1.6;color:#b0b0b0;margin:0}.Start_highlight__u6cEQ{color:#00a67e;font-weight:600}.Start_rulesSection__za5pB{display:flex;flex-direction:column;gap:1rem;margin-bottom:2rem;max-width:600px;width:100%}.Start_ruleCard__owarr{background-color:#2a2a2a;border:1px solid #444;border-radius:12px;padding:1.5rem;box-shadow:0 4px 6px rgba(0,0,0,.1)}.Start_ruleHeader__5oW4Q{font-size:1.1rem;font-weight:600;color:#f5f5f5;margin:0 0 1rem;display:flex;align-items:center;gap:.5rem}.Start_ruleIcon__LXxqa{font-size:1.3rem}.Start_ruleList__WCYJG{margin:0;padding:0;list-style:none}.Start_ruleList__WCYJG li{font-size:.95rem;line-height:1.5;color:#b0b0b0;margin-bottom:.75rem;padding-left:1rem;position:relative}.Start_ruleList__WCYJG li:last-child{margin-bottom:0}.Start_ruleList__WCYJG li:before{content:"•";color:#00a67e;font-weight:700;position:absolute;left:0}.Start_actionSection__KtPSz{display:flex;flex-direction:column;align-items:center;gap:1rem}.Start_startButton__FpLLa{background-color:#007acc;color:white;border:none;padding:16px 32px;border-radius:8px;font-size:1.1rem;font-weight:600;cursor:pointer;transition:all .2s ease;min-width:200px;text-transform:none;letter-spacing:.025em;box-shadow:0 2px 4px rgba(0,122,204,.2)}.Start_startButton__FpLLa:hover:not(:disabled){background-color:#005fa3;transform:translateY(-1px);box-shadow:0 4px 8px rgba(0,122,204,.3)}.Start_startButton__FpLLa:active:not(:disabled){transform:translateY(0);box-shadow:0 2px 4px rgba(0,122,204,.2)}.Start_startButton__FpLLa:disabled{background-color:#666;cursor:not-allowed;transform:none;box-shadow:none}.Start_resumeButton__mSLKc{background-color:#00a67e;color:white;border:none;padding:16px 32px;border-radius:8px;font-size:1.1rem;font-weight:600;cursor:pointer;transition:all .2s ease;min-width:200px;text-transform:none;letter-spacing:.025em;box-shadow:0 2px 4px rgba(0,166,126,.2)}.Start_resumeButton__mSLKc:hover:not(:disabled){background-color:#008a6a;transform:translateY(-1px);box-shadow:0 4px 8px rgba(0,166,126,.3)}.Start_resumeButton__mSLKc:active:not(:disabled){transform:translateY(0);box-shadow:0 2px 4px rgba(0,166,126,.2)}.Start_resumeButton__mSLKc:disabled{background-color:#666;cursor:not-allowed;transform:none;box-shadow:none}.Start_buttonText__154KV{display:flex;align-items:center;justify-content:center;gap:.5rem}.Start_statusText__rateS{font-size:.9rem;color:#888;text-align:center;margin-top:.5rem}.Start_loading__DxK5Y{opacity:.7;pointer-events:none}@media (max-width:768px){.Start_container__fvhKK{padding:1rem;min-height:60vh}.Start_title__ld2KS{font-size:2rem}.Start_subtitle__fT07k{font-size:1rem}.Start_instructionsCard__YOuE1{padding:1.5rem;margin-bottom:1.5rem}.Start_rulesSection__za5pB{gap:1rem;margin-bottom:2rem}.Start_ruleCard__owarr{padding:1.25rem}.Start_resumeButton__mSLKc,.Start_startButton__FpLLa{padding:14px 28px;font-size:1rem;min-width:180px}}@media (max-width:480px){.Start_container__fvhKK{padding:1rem .5rem}.Start_title__ld2KS{font-size:1.75rem}.Start_instructionsCard__YOuE1{padding:1rem}.Start_resumeButton__mSLKc,.Start_startButton__FpLLa{padding:12px 24px;min-width:160px;font-size:.95rem}}@keyframes Start_fadeInUp__NW1HP{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.Start_container__fvhKK>*{animation:Start_fadeInUp__NW1HP .6s ease-out}.Start_titleSection__Q9PNk{animation-delay:.1s}.Start_instructionsCard__YOuE1{animation-delay:.2s}.Start_rulesSection__za5pB{animation-delay:.25s}.Start_actionSection__KtPSz{animation-delay:.3s}.Timer_timer__aZgPT{border-bottom-left-radius:6px;border-bottom-right-radius:6px;padding:12px;font-size:14px;font-weight:600;color:white;background:linear-gradient(135deg,#3b82f6,#1d4ed8);box-shadow:0 2px 4px rgba(0,0,0,.1);z-index:10;min-width:120px;text-align:center;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.Timer_minutes__tkKBM{font-size:12px;font-weight:400}@media (max-width:768px){.Timer_timer__aZgPT{font-size:12px;padding:8px;min-width:100px}}.ReqCounter_counter__keJvi{border-bottom-left-radius:6px;border-bottom-right-radius:6px;padding:12px;font-size:14px;font-weight:600;color:white;box-shadow:0 2px 4px rgba(0,0,0,.1);z-index:10;min-width:150px;text-align:center;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.ReqCounter_main__iFA5z{font-weight:600;margin-bottom:2px}.ReqCounter_breakdown__8vF5k{font-size:12px;opacity:.9;font-weight:400}.ReqCounter_plenty__omC3t{background:linear-gradient(135deg,#10b981,#059669)}.ReqCounter_warning__THY8U{background:linear-gradient(135deg,#f59e0b,#d97706)}.ReqCounter_critical__GYLLL{background:linear-gradient(135deg,#ef4444,#dc2626)}@media (max-width:768px){.ReqCounter_counter__keJvi{right:125px;font-size:12px;padding:8px;min-width:100px}.ReqCounter_breakdown__8vF5k{font-size:10px}}.InterviewHome_container__fhyni{display:flex;flex-direction:column;height:100vh}.InterviewHome_tabs__RfCar{display:flex;border-bottom:1px solid #444;height:50px;align-items:center}.InterviewHome_tabButton__J2E_G{padding:10px 20px;cursor:pointer;background-color:transparent;border:none;color:#f5f5f5;font-size:16px;outline:none}.InterviewHome_tabButton__J2E_G.InterviewHome_active__tExRa{border-bottom:2px solid #00a67e;color:#00a67e}.InterviewHome_tabButton__J2E_G.InterviewHome_disabled__cBZEC{color:#666;cursor:not-allowed;opacity:.5}.InterviewHome_tabButton__J2E_G.InterviewHome_disabled__cBZEC:hover{color:#666;background-color:transparent}.InterviewHome_rightComponents__slpH0{position:absolute;right:20px;top:0;display:flex;gap:8px;align-items:flex-start;z-index:10}.InterviewHome_userInfo__FJwRQ{position:absolute;right:20px;text-align:center}@media (max-width:768px){.InterviewHome_rightComponents__slpH0{right:10px;gap:6px}}